Texas Bar Foundation Shows The Love For North Texas Nonprofits With $82,941 In Grants

The Texas Bar Foundation presented more than $1.35M to nonprofits this year. The North Texas organizations that received $82,941 in grants benefiting area residents are

  • ACT (Advocates for Community Transformation) — $20,000 for “Seed Stage Launch-Empowering South Oak Cliff Residents To Take Back Their Street”
  • Alliance for Children — $15,441 for “Child Homicide Investigation Training For Child Abuse Professionals”
  • Catholic Charities Dallas — $7,500 for “Paperless Transition Project”
  • Dallas Bar Association Community Service Fund — $15,000 for “Entrepreneurs In Community Lawyering Program”
  • Housing Crisis Center — $7,500 for “Legal Services For The Indigent”
  • Junior League of Dallas — $2,500 for “Young Trailblazers And Scholars Program”
  • Poetic — $15,000 for “Poetic Pipeline To Success Program For Trafficked And Exploited Girls”

Over the years, the Texas Bar Foundation has provided more than $20M in grant to charitable organizations in Texas.
